Get in Touch** The Toyota repair market serving Wildie, KY is characterized by high-quality, independent shops rather than branded dealerships or specialists that exclusively work on Toyotas. The closest Toyota dealerships are in Richmond or London, each about a 30-40 minute drive. Consequently, the local market in Mount Vernon and Berea has adapted to fill this need with highly competent generalists who have developed deep expertise with the Toyota brand due to its high local prevalence. **Competition Level:** Moderate. There are several reputable shops, but none explicitly advertise as "Toyota-only." Success is driven by reputation and word-of-mouth. **Average Quality** is notably high, with many shops boasting Google ratings of 4.6 stars or above, reflecting a community that values trustworthy and reliable service. **Typical Pricing** is significantly more affordable than dealership rates, with labor rates estimated in the $90-$110/hour range, which is competitive for rural Kentucky. For highly specialized services like advanced hybrid system repair, residents may still need to travel to a dealership, but for the vast majority of needs—including engine, transmission, and AWD service—the local providers are exceptionally capable and cost-effective.

Due to our rural roads and seasonal temperature swings, common repairs for Toyotas in Wildie include suspension components (struts, control arms), brake services due to hilly terrain, and addressing check engine lights related to oxygen sensors or catalytic converters, which are frequent on older models. Regular undercarriage inspections for rust are also wise given winter road treatments.

The gravel and uneven back roads around Wildie mean you should have your alignment, tires, and suspension checked more frequently. Also, preparing your cooling system for humid Kentucky summers and your battery for colder winter snaps is crucial, as our seasonal extremes stress vehicle systems more than a mild climate would.
